McDonnell Douglas DC-9-82 N434AA
2 May 1989 · Minneapolis, Minnesota, United States · No injuries
Summary
On 2 May 1989 at about 19:40 local time, a McDonnell Douglas DC-9-82 registered N434AA was involved in an incident near Minneapolis, Minnesota, United States. 96 people were on board and nobody was injured. The aircraft was slightly damaged. The NTSB has published a probable cause for this accident; it is quoted in full below.

Probable cause
FAILURE OF THE HYDRAULIC POWER TRANSFER UNIT SHUT-OFF (PTU S/O) VALVE DUE TO FAILED (FATIGUED) VALVE BODY ATTACH SCREWS.
